// Nightly search reindex client for the Quillhaven catalog service.
// This job runs at 02:10 local time, after the merchandising sync
// completes, to avoid racing partial writes. We intentionally use the
// low-priority indexer pool so daytime query latency is unaffected.
// Reviewers: please confirm the backoff settings match the Indexer
// team's guidance. The client authenticates against the internal
// Lanternworks indexing gateway using the key below.

gateway credential: kto23_LX9A4ys6i4nzHtpOLNLodKK

Handover for weekly sync — Quillbase ORM refactor. I've migrated the order and invoice models off the legacy Ironquill ORM onto the new repository layer; session handling is now explicit. Remaining work: the reporting module still uses raw Ironquill queries. The migration toolkit is locked behind the maintenance vault, which opens with the recovery passphrase below.

vault phrase of bagaf-kajeg = jorath-feniel-briir-siliel-ralix

## Tailing logs with `plumctl`

Plugin authors debugging against the Fernlake staging mesh should use `plumctl tail` rather than raw node access. Pass your plugin slug with `--scope` to filter; omit it and you get the whole firehose, which will be rate-limited. Add `--since 15m` to bound the window. Output is structured JSON; pipe through `plumctl fmt` for readable lines. Sessions auto-expire after 30 minutes. Flag reference, auth setup, and known quirks for third-party builds are kept on the page below.

runbook for tajep-yahig: https://artifactory.lumictech.corp/repo

Step 6 — Deep-link routing. Before cutting the Wayfolk mobile release, confirm the link-router service resolves app links for both staging and prod schemes. The router won't start without its signing credential, so pop open the env file on the router host and add the following line:

secret setting of kajef-yahag: RELAY_SECRET20=f7a001bb8ebd9be883d6